After a 3-month lengthy debate amongst its neighborhood members, Wikimedia Foundation (WMF), the no-profit group behind the web encyclopedia Wikipedia, has determined to cease accepting cryptocurrency donations. Before this choice, WMF used to simply accept contributions in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Bitcoin Cash.  

A Wikimedia editor, Molly White, started a dialogue within the Wikimedia neighborhood to rethink its choice to simply accept cryptocurrency as a way of donation. This led to a web-based dialogue amongst members from 10 January 2022 to 12 April 2022. Finally, voting was performed the place a majority of the neighborhood individuals favored White’s proposal. 

The arguments put forth towards crypto donations included environmental unsustainability and harm to Wikimedia’s popularity as accepting the donations meant endorsing no matter digital property stand for. 

About 400 neighborhood members participated within the debate, and new and unregistered ones had been excluded from the voting. The Wikimedia neighborhood voted for the discontinuation of crypto donations by 232 to 94, or 71.17%. Subsequently, they requested Wikipedia’s guardian group to discontinue cryptocurrency donations.  

Wikimedia Discontinues Crypto Donations

On May 1, Molly White broke the information on Twitter that Wikimedia has accepted the neighborhood’s request and stopped accepting crypto donations. 

“The Wikimedia Foundation has decided to stop accepting cryptocurrency donations. The decision was made based on a community request that the WMF no longer accepts crypto donations, which came out of a three-month-long discussion that wrapped up earlier this month,” she tweeted, together with a Wikipedia assertion purportedly to the neighborhood members.  

The doc added that the Wikimedia Foundation had begun accepting cryptocurrency in 2014 in step with requests from “volunteers and donor communities.” Wikimedia Foundation will shut its Bitpay account, which is able to take away its means to immediately settle for cryptocurrency as a technique of donating, the assertion defined. However, the group additionally stated it’s an “evolving matter.” 

WMF Received $130,000 in Crypto Donations in 2021

The debate started with Molly White asking how a lot cash Wikimedia has acquired in crypto donations. WMF replied that the donations it acquired final yr in digital property amounted to a little bit over $130,000, or 0.08% of its income. The most used cryptocurrency was bitcoin, and all donations had been spot transformed into fiat USD. 

It additionally noticed some members discussing the advantages of “Proof of Stake” compared to “Proof of Work,” the previous being thought-about to be much less energy-intensive. The debate that exceeded 60,000 phrases mentioned many different points similar to cash laundering, use of cryptocurrency in crime and scams, pseudonym donation, mining ban in Russia, central banks’ fiat foreign money system, and its flaws. 

Crypto Donations: A Topic of Growing Importance

Wikimedia’s newest choice has as soon as once more introduced a highlight on the rising significance of crypto donations. 

In the continuing Russia-Ukraine struggle, the latter has acquired over $100 million in crypto donations, to date. And, fearing Russian interference, Ireland has lately banned crypto donations for political events.

Last month, a Republican member of Louisiana, Mark Right, launched a invoice within the state legislature that sought to put down guidelines for crypto donations for political campaigns.
